Welcome to the Lanternbeam release crew! Quick heads-up: our events table in Quillhaven is partitioned by month, so every cut needs the partition migration baked in before you tag. Don't skip it — January's incident taught us that. Once the migration is staged, sign the release bundle with the key below.

rollout seal: bky3_Zik

# CrumbOrder — Environments

CrumbOrder enforces the bakery order-cutoff rule: orders placed after the cutoff roll to the next baking day. Plugin authors should test against the sandbox environment, which uses a simulated clock, before targeting production. Cutoff times differ per environment and per bakery region. Each environment exposes its behaviour through the configuration values that follow.

settings of fafog-haduf:
ZORIX_PIN=4648
ZORIX_METRICS_HOST=metrics.zorix.paliqsys.corp
ZORIX_LOG_LEVEL=info
ZORIX_TENANT=druix

Handover note — Crumbwheel order cutoffs.

Welcome aboard. The bakery cutoff rule in Crumbwheel closes same-day orders at 14:00 local to each storefront, not UTC — this has bitten us twice. Holiday overrides live in the calendar service and take precedence silently, so always check there first when a cutoff looks wrong. To unlock the calendar service's admin console after a restart, enter the recovery passphrase below.

vault phrase of bagap-bahaf = silion-pelox-sorox-casdor-quenwyn-fraax-eliox-praael-kelion-quenvan-kasox-rusael-norius-belvan

- [ ] **Step 7: Breaker override escrow.** After sealing the signing keys for the Tallgrove upstream API circuit breaker, confirm the support team can force the breaker open during a full outage. The override bundle lives in the sealed escrow drawer and is useless without its unlock phrase. Two ceremony witnesses must initial this step before proceeding. The escrow bundle is decrypted with the recovery passphrase that follows.

vault phrase of kahip-kahop = holath-quenmir

**CI note: Partner SFTP drop failing in nightly**

The Grayharbor partner drop job times out during handshake since the key rotation last week. Not our code — their host key changed and the pinned fingerprint in the fixture is stale. Updated the fixture and bumped the timeout to 45s. Please review the diff narrowly; no logic changes. Verified green on the build referenced below.

session token of fawep-tajep = htk14_4221f8eaf43a2f